Relevance
Component of a heteromeric calcium-permeable ion channel formed by PKD1 and PKD2 that is activated by interaction between PKD1 and a Wnt family member, such as WNT3A and WNT9B (PubMed:27214281) . Both PKD1 and PKD2 are required for channel activity (PubMed:27214281) . Involved in renal tubulogenesis (PubMed:12482949) . Involved in fluid-flow mechanosensation by the primary cilium in renal epithelium (By similarity) . Acts as a regulator of cilium length, together with PKD2 (By similarity) . The dynamic control of cilium length is essential in the regulation of mechanotransductive signaling (By similarity) . The cilium length response creates a negative feedback loop whereby fluid shear-mediated deflection of the primary cilium, which decreases intracellular cAMP, leads to cilium shortening and thus decreases flow-induced signaling (By similarity) . May be an ion-channel regulator. Involved in adhesive protein-protein and protein-carbohydrate interactions.
